▌ Editor's read The provided URL loads directly to the Camp Invention program page for Herbison Woods Elementary School in DeWitt, MI, confirming it as a legitimate camp offering. This specific program, 'Spark,' is designed for grades K-6 and runs from June 17-21, 2024. As a Camp Invention program, it is developed by the National Inventors Hall of Fame, indicating a well-established curriculum focused on STEM, innovation, and invention. The Camp Invention website states that all program directors and instructors are local educators and that all staff undergo background checks. The program is a day camp, operating from 9:00 AM to 3:30 PM. While specific Google reviews for this particular school's Camp Invention program are not readily available, Camp Invention as a national program generally receives positive feedback for its engaging and educational content. The camp is owned and operated by Herbison Woods Elementary School, making it a school-based program.
